Golden hour sunset on Saguaro Cactus skeleton
The Sonoran Desert in southern Arizona has a great diversity of Cacti. This arid climate also leaves behind the dead, fibrous cacti skeleton. Walking one evening through this landscape the late evening, golden light fell upon this skeleton and lit up the fibrous remains with a warm, golden light.
